The worst thing for a rider is to run into another teammate during a MotoGP race, as happened this Sunday in South African from KTM Brad Binder that he suddenly saw Pecco Bagnaia lying in the middle of the track.
Bagnaia, who started from pole, pulled off a strike in the middle of the group when he went through turn 1 organized by his teammate Bastianini and included four other Ducatis, but he risked getting away from the Aprilias on the exit of the turn. 2 the Ducati sent him into the air and he fell to the ground, leaving him in the middle of the track. The first riders avoided him, but Binder, coming into the middle of the group at full speed, was unable to avoid him and ran over his feet.
“I didn’t see anything. I had two bikes there in front of me, so when I ran into someone, it was the bike and him. I was between Miguel Oliveira and I think Maverick Viñales. So I couldn’t do anything, it didn’t happen happy. After all, it’s the worst nightmare for any driver… well, it’s scary to see someone there, I tell you, but to be the one who crashed into him is even more ridiculous, to be honest”, Brad recounts after the race.
However, he had the expertise to prevent Bagnaia’s injuries from becoming more serious in a motorcycle maneuver trying to jump: “The good thing is, I saw Pecco move, he was moving and conscious, but I know he touched his leg, or his legs, I don’t know, but he also maneuvered so that he wouldn’t get angry. catch him whole, and luckily, that seems to be enough”, Brad revealed.

After the second start, Binder retired and went straight to the Circuit’s medical center to ask about Bagnaia. “I went to see Pecco, he seems to be okay, I don’t know if it’s okay, but it doesn’t seem like anything serious. He is conscious all the time. When I walked in I didn’t expect to see him relaxed, and he seemed to be okay,” he explained..
After undergoing several diagnostic tests at the General Hospital of Catalonia, Pecco Bagnaia left the hospital on his own two feet and traveled back home with the rest of the Ducati team with only a few bruises on his body. In the team’s statement, he said that “it was not a normal highside and it is very difficult for me to find an explanation for what happened. It was a very strange fall and luckily I did not do anything serious. Training is already in the lap I noticed that I had little grip on the rear tire. Now we will try everything to get back on track at this weekend’s Grand Prix in Misano.”
